How to Make Caipirinha

The classic caipirinha is the mother of all Brazilian cocktails. This refreshing 3-ingredient drink, is the perfect treat to spend a great summer afternoon with your amigos and familia. It's a delicious cocktail that pairs wonderfully with a churrasco, and all things grilled. Your summer bbq festas will never be the same! - recipe makes 2 servings.

Ingredients

  • 5 whole limes
  • 3 tbsp sugar
  • 3/4 cup cachaça
  • ice to taste

Instructions

  • juice 3 of the limes and set aside - you'll want about a 1/3 of a cup of juice, give or take
  • cut the other 2 limes in 8 pieces each
  • Add the sugar and the lime pieces to a cup and muddle until you've juiced all the little pieces and they're nicely combined with the sugar
  • add the lime juice and the cachaça to the muddled limes and stir gently to dissolve the sugar - approx. 2 minutes
  • fill 2 cups with ice, and top them with caipirinha
